T1A Amateur Radio, F.C.C., License Classes, Renewal
F.C.C.
The Federal Communications Commission in Washington makes and enforces all the rules andregulations pertaining to amateur radio. They can grant or take away licenses or impose fines onamateurs if they are not following their rules.An amateur station in definition is a station in the amateur service who is responsible for radio communications. Any licensed amateurwho is responsible for the stations transmissions is called the
control operator
.
For Example:
If you allow your friend to use your radio equipment to talk, then you areresponsible for his transmission because the station is yours.

Amateur Radio License
In order to operate a station in the U.S., an F.C.C Amateur Primary License is required. This license is good for a period of ten yearsafter which it must be renewed.
How Soon Can I Operate My Station?
As soon as the FCC's computer database shows that you have been granted a license, you are authorized to operate your station if youwish.
License Classes
The F.C.C. has broken the Amateur Radio Service into 3.5 license classes. You must start as a Technician class operator and climb theladder.(You can't skip. You must start out as a Technician and work your way up to the highest license class.) If you wish to gain moreprivileges than the ones you have, the F.C.C. requires that you pass an exam for you to gain the additional privileges of a higher classlicense.
